Location & geography
Buckner is situated in southwestern Arkansas, making it well-positioned near a variety of other small towns. Notable nearby cities include Stamps, located just 8 miles to the southwest, and Lewisville, approximately 12 miles to the northeast. The city covers a total land area of 63.37 square miles, with a small water area of 0.16 square miles, contributing to its predominantly rural landscape.

Transportation
Buckner is accessible via Highway 79, which links it to nearby regions and facilitates ease of travel. The city does not have its own airport, but the nearest major airport can be found in Texarkana, which is about 27 miles away. Public transportation options are limited, reflecting the rural nature of the area.
